Underpinning foundation repair services involve strengthening or stabilizing the existing foundation of a property to address issues caused by shifting, settling, or structural damage. This process typically includes installing support piers or posts beneath the foundation to lift and stabilize the structure. The goal is to restore the integrity of the building’s foundation, preventing further movement or damage. Skilled service providers use various techniques tailored to the specific needs of each property, ensuring that the repair work is durable and effective.

These services help resolve common foundation problems such as u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and visible settling or sinking of the property. Over time, so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ction can cause a foundation to shift, leading to structural concerns. Underpinning can correct these issues by providing additional support, which helps maintain the safety and stability of the home. Addressing foundation problems early can also prevent more costly repairs in the future, making underpinning an important option for homeowners facing signs of foundation distress.

Properties that typically require underpinning foundation repair include older homes with settled or uneven foundations, new constructions experiencing unexpected shifts, or buildings situated on unstable soil. Commercial buildings, garages, and additions to existing homes may also benefit from this service if they show signs of movement or structural concerns. Underpinning is suitable for various property types, especially those where foundation stability is compromised or where the homeowner wants to reinforce the structure’s safety and longevity.

The overview below groups typical Underpinning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newport, KY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or underpinning or foundation stabilization in Newport, KY,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ering common repairs for small areas or localized issues.

Moderate Projects - Projects involving partial foundation reinforcement or repair often c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These are common for homeowners addressing more extensive settling or minor cracks across larger sections.

Major Repairs - Larger, more complex underpinning projects can range from $4,000 to $8,000, especially when multiple areas require reinforcement or additional structural support.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they are necessary for significant foundation concerns.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ement in Newport can exceed $20,000, depending on the size and complexity of the property. Such extensive work is less common but essential for severe foundation failure or structural instability.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is underpinning foundation repair? Underpinning foundation repair invol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ation when it has become damaged or unstable, helping to prevent further issues.

How do local contractors perform underpinning services? Local contractors assess the foundation’s condition, then use methods such as piering or mudjacking to restore stability and support the structure.

What signs indicate a need for underpinning foundation repair? Signs include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ly.

Are there different techniques used for underpinning foundation repair? Yes, techniques vary depending on the foundation type and damage, commonly including pier installation, mudjacking, or soil stabilization methods.
